简介:<
在繁华的上海,代办执照已成为众多创业者首选的服务之一。随着业务的不断扩展,如何确保架构设计的扩展性成为关键。本文将深入探讨上海代办执照的架构设计,分析其扩展性应考虑的要点,助您企业快速起航。
一、系统架构设计的重要性
1. 系统稳定性
系统稳定性是架构设计的基础,尤其是在面对大量用户和复杂业务场景时。以下是确保系统稳定性的几个关键点:
- 模块化设计:将系统划分为独立的模块,便于管理和扩展。
- 负载均衡:通过分布式部署,实现负载均衡,提高系统处理能力。
- 冗余设计:关键组件采用冗余设计,确保在单点故障时系统仍能正常运行。
2. 系统可扩展性
随着业务的发展,系统需要具备良好的可扩展性。以下是从三个方面阐述如何提高系统的可扩展性:
- 水平扩展:通过增加服务器数量来提高系统处理能力,适用于读多写少的场景。
- 垂直扩展:通过升级服务器硬件来提高系统性能,适用于写多读少的场景。
- 微服务架构:将系统拆分为多个微服务,每个服务独立部署,便于扩展和维护。
3. 系统安全性
安全性是架构设计的重要考量因素,以下是从三个方面确保系统安全:
- 数据加密:对敏感数据进行加密处理,防止数据泄露。
- 访问控制:实施严格的访问控制策略,确保只有授权用户才能访问系统。
- 安全审计:定期进行安全审计,及时发现并修复潜在的安全漏洞。
4. 系统性能优化
性能优化是提高用户体验的关键。以下是从三个方面进行性能优化的策略:
- 缓存机制:通过缓存常用数据,减少数据库访问次数,提高系统响应速度。
- 数据库优化:对数据库进行优化,提高查询效率。
- 前端优化:优化前端代码,减少页面加载时间。
5. 系统可维护性
良好的可维护性有助于降低系统维护成本,以下是从三个方面提高系统可维护性:
- 代码规范:制定严格的代码规范,提高代码质量。
- 文档完善:编写详细的系统文档,方便后续维护和升级。
- 自动化测试:实施自动化测试,确保系统稳定性和可靠性。
6. 系统兼容性
系统兼容性是确保用户在不同设备和操作系统上都能正常使用的关键。以下是从两个方面提高系统兼容性:
- 跨平台开发:采用跨平台开发技术,确保系统在不同平台上运行。
- 浏览器兼容性:针对不同浏览器进行测试和优化,提高用户体验。
结尾:
上海加喜公司注册地专业提供上海代办执照服务,我们深知架构设计扩展性的重要性。在为您的企业提供代办执照服务的我们注重系统架构的优化,确保系统具备良好的稳定性、可扩展性、安全性、性能和可维护性。选择加喜,让您的企业快速起航,迈向成功!